protected function imagick_orient_image(\Imagick $image) { $orientation = $image->getImageOrientation(); $background = new \ImagickPixel('none'); switch ($orientation) { case \imagick::ORIENTATION_TOPRIGHT: // 2 $image->flopImage(); // horizontal flop around y-axis break; case \imagick::ORIENTATION_BOTTOMRIGHT: // 3 $image->rotateImage($background, 180); break; case \imagick::ORIENTATION_BOTTOMLEFT: // 4 $image->flipImage(); // vertical flip around x-axis break; case \imagick::ORIENTATION_LEFTTOP: // 5 $image->flopImage(); // horizontal flop around y-axis $image->rotateImage($background, 270); break; case \imagick::ORIENTATION_RIGHTTOP: // 6 $image->rotateImage($background, 90); break; case \imagick::ORIENTATION_RIGHTBOTTOM: // 7 $image->flipImage(); // vertical flip around x-axis $image->rotateImage($background, 270); break; case \imagick::ORIENTATION_LEFTBOTTOM: // 8 $image->rotateImage($background, 270); break; default: return false; } $image->setImageOrientation(\imagick::ORIENTATION_TOPLEFT); // 1 return true; }
